The following real estate market statistics are from the Northwest Multiple Listing Service.

 

Selling Your Snohomish County House:

Avg DOM

The Snohomish County Market Report shows that in July 2015 there were a total of 1,931 active homes, 973 Pending Homes and 1,069 homes that sold in Snohomish County, WA. What does that mean to you as a seller? The Active homes are what your direct competition is. If there are two of the same houses active on the market a buyer is most likely going to buy the least expensive house of the two choices. That is why you want to be competitive when pricing your house for sale. The pending homes and sold homes show you what people are willing to pay for a house like yours.  Homes on average are closing in about 31 days according the the Market Dynamics report.

Right now inventory is up 20.3% year to date which means there is more competition out there. With that being said, there is still only 1.8 months of inventory making it a sellers market still. The average sales price in Snohomish County is up 9.2% year to date. That means that you can get about 9% more for your home this year vs. last year. Some areas in Snohomish County are up to 14% more in price compared to last year! Houses on average are selling 9.4% faster than they were last year. That is great news for home sellers! The average time a house sits on the market is 48 days. Some areas are selling faster sitting on the market around 30 days. Location greatly determines the price and how fast your home will sell.

Inventory in Snohomish CountyYou can see here that the inventory of homes for sale is slowly increasing. This is good news for buyers because you will have more homes to choose from with less competition. However, this shows that there are still only 1.8 months of inventory in Snohomish County. That is still lower than a balanced market. 1.8 months of inventory means that if no one else puts their house on the market in 1.8 months there will no longer be any homes for sale in Snohomish County. This is great for sellers because there is less competition than in a balanced market. Buyers will act quicker on making offers because homes are selling quickly and for pull price.
